Ayumu Murase

Description
Ayumu Murase is a Japanese voice actor born on December 14, 1988, in Los Angeles, California. He spent his early childhood in the United States before relocating to Aichi Prefecture in Japan, where he lived through his high school years. He later attended university in Kyoto Prefecture. Murase's interest in performance led him to enroll in the Japan Narration Actors Institute during his second year of college, and he joined the talent agency VIMS in 2010.

Murase made his professional debut in 2011 with a small role in the anime Persona 4: The Animation. His first major recurring role came in 2012 as the 14-year-old version of Shun Aonuma in the science fiction series From the New World. However, his career breakthrough arrived in 2014 when he was cast as the energetic protagonist Shoyo Hinata in the popular sports anime Haikyu!!, marking his first leading role in a television series. This performance established him as a rising talent in the industry.

In 2016, Murase's growing prominence was recognized when he received the Best New Actor award at the 10th Seiyu Awards, sharing the honor with fellow recipients. This accolade highlighted his rapid ascent since his debut. After 13 years with VIMS, Murase departed from the agency on April 30, 2023, to establish his own personal agency, Aster Nine, effective May 1, 2023, seeking greater autonomy in managing his career.

Murase is renowned for his distinctive high-pitched and androgynous vocal quality, which enables him to portray a wide spectrum of characters across age and gender. He frequently voices pre-pubescent boys, characters who appear androgynous or cross-dress, and even ordinary female roles with a naturalness that often surprises listeners. His vocal range also extends to lower-pitched, more mature characters, demonstrating considerable versatility. This ability to seamlessly transition between different vocal registers has led to the popular saying among fans about the "proper way to use Ayumu Murase". He is also noted for his competent singing ability, often performing while maintaining character voices, and for his proficiency in English, which he utilizes in roles requiring English dialogue.

Among his numerous and varied roles are Shoyo Hinata in Haikyu!!, Iruma Suzuki in Welcome to Demon School, Iruma-kun, and Luck Voltia in Black Clover. He also voiced the title character Joker in Mysterious Joker, Allen Walker in D.Gray-man HALLOW, and Kazuki Yasaka in Sarazanmai. In 2021, he portrayed the shadowy companion Kage in Ranking of Kings. The year 2022 saw him in roles such as Kappei in Ninjala, Solomon in She Professed Herself Pupil of the Wise Man, and Jinon in Love of Kill. His film work includes roles in The Seven Deadly Sins: Grudge of Edinburgh as Tristan and Goodbye, Don Glees! as Shizuku "Drop" Sakuma. He also voices the popular character Venti in the video game Genshin Impact.

In a historic casting decision for the long-running Pretty Cure franchise, Murase was chosen to voice Tsubasa Yuunagi / Cure Wing in the 2023 series Soaring Sky! Pretty Cure, becoming the first male voice actor to play a main Cure character. He has also taken on other significant roles, including Dali in Migi & Dali and Crimson in Ragna Crimson. Murase continues to be an active and sought-after voice actor, with recent projects including the role of Mitile in Mahō Tsukai no Yakusoku - Promise of Wizard.
